Contact Center Officer
by Ad Ports Group in Logistics & Supply Chain
The Contact Center Officer is responsible for delivering high-quality, professional, and consistent customer support services across all customer interaction channels within a 24/7 shift-based operational environment. The role supports AD Ports Group's commitment to customer excellence by managing customer interactions through inbound and outbound calls, emails, online chat, webforms, WhatsApp, digital platforms, and other communication channels available within the Contact Center ecosystem. The position serves as a primary point of contact for customers, ensuring efficient handling of inquiries, requests, complaints, feedback, service-related concerns, and all case types while maintaining the highest standards of customer experience, service quality, professionalism, confidentiality, and regulatory compliance. The Contact Center Officer is responsible for identifying customer requirements, clarifying information, researching issues, providing accurate information, recommending solutions, and ensuring customer concerns are resolved in accordance with approved procedures, service recovery guidelines, scripts, and customer experience standards. The role requires effective management of customer cases through CRM systems and related databases, including case logging, tracking, updating, monitoring, escalation, resolution, documentation, and closure within established Service Level Agreements (SLAs). The position leverages AI-enabled customer service technologies and automation tools including chatbots, virtual assistants, smart routing solutions, auto-suggestions, knowledge base recommendations, sentiment analysis tools, and case categorization systems to improve efficiency, response accuracy, service consistency, and customer satisfaction while maintaining human oversight, validation, and professional judgment. The Contact Center Officer manages high volumes of omni-channel customer interactions, performs outbound calls, follow-ups, call-backs, customer surveys, awareness campaigns, and service-related communications as assigned. The role requires maintaining current knowledge of company services, policies, procedures, operational systems, customer service processes, and fleet information to provide accurate and timely responses. The position works closely with internal departments, focal points, management teams, and operational stakeholders to facilitate case resolution, ensure information accuracy, and deliver seamless customer experiences. Responsibilities also include ensuring strict compliance with data privacy regulations, information security requirements, quality standards, customer confidentiality obligations, and corporate governance policies. The Contact Center Officer contributes to customer service initiatives, customer experience improvement projects, process enhancement activities, quality assurance programs, operational excellence initiatives, and customer satisfaction objectives while demonstrating flexibility to work day shifts, night shifts, weekends, and public holidays as part of a continuous 24/7 customer service operation. The role requires previous customer support or contact center experience, proficiency in CRM systems, familiarity with AI-enabled customer service technologies, strong verbal and written communication abilities in English and Arabic, active listening skills, customer service expertise, case management capabilities, and the ability to operate effectively in a dynamic customer-focused environment.
